Comprehensive Guide to Form 5 Ownership Changes

What is the Form 5 Annual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ership?

Form 5 is a legal document filed with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) to disclose changes in beneficial ownership of securities by insiders. Its primary purpose is to ensure transparency in financial markets and compliance with regulations. Under the Securities Exchange Act, it is crucial for directors, officers, and 10% owners to report transactions that involve their company's securities. A "reporting person" includes any individual or entity that has to disclose these changes due to their significant ownership stake.

Who Needs to File the Form 5 Annual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ership?

Filing Form 5 is necessary for various roles, including directors, officers, and individuals owning 10% or more of a company's securities. These roles trigger the need to file based on significant changes in beneficial ownership. Understanding the eligibility criteria for filing is essential for compliance.
  • Directors
  • Officers
  • Ten percent owners

When and How to Submit the Form 5 Annual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ership

Filing deadlines for Form 5 are crucial and typically follow the end of a company's fiscal year. Submit the form using methods such as online filing or mailing options. After submission, ensure to obtain a confirmation of receipt to track the submission effectively.
  • File within 45 days after the fiscal year-end
  • Choose between online submission or hard copy

FAQs

If you can't find what you're looking for, please contact us anytime!
Form 5 can be filed by company insiders including directors, officers, and 10% owners who must disclose changes in their beneficial ownership of securities.
Form 5 must be filed within 45 days after the end of the fiscal year in which the transactions occur to ensure compliance with SEC regulations.
You can submit Form 5 electronically through the SEC's EDGAR system or follow your company’s internal procedures for submission and compliance.
You will need a record of your ownership transactions, details about the securities, and your relationship to the issuer to complete Form 5.
Ensure all fields are accurately filled, avoid omitting transactions, and double-check electronic signatures to prevent delays in processing.
Processing times can vary, but typically SEC filings are acknowledged promptly upon submission. It is essential to file correctly to avoid delays.
Yes, an attorney in-fact can sign and submit Form 5 on behalf of the reporting person, provided they have the proper authorization.
